Graviton 2 uses the ARMv8.2 architecture, which does not have native support for nested virtualization, which is added in ARMv8.3. Storage virtualization combines the functions of physical storage devices such as network attached storage (NAS) and storage area network (SAN). Microsoft Azure has support for nested virtualization for some specific instance types where you can launch a guest operating system on top of your virtual machine.. AWS has full support to the nested virtualization only in bare metal instance types.
